How do arcade operators handle maintenance schedules for their machines?

Arcade operators follow structured maintenance schedules to keep their machines in top condition, ensuring a seamless gaming experience for players. Regular tasks include cleaning components, inspecting wiring, and testing software to prevent malfunctions. Many operators use digital logs or maintenance apps to track repairs and schedule routine checkups. Common issues like joystick wear, button responsiveness, and screen calibration are addressed promptly. By prioritizing preventive care, operators extend machine lifespans and minimize downtime, keeping their arcades profitable and enjoyable for customers.
